Smarter ways to face down fraud

Smarter ways to face down fraud

  • The rapid growth of e-commerce and digital services has created new vulnerabilities for fraud and cybercrime.
  • Both "friendly" (e.g. chargebacks, returns abuse) and "unfriendly" (e.g. account takeovers, data breaches) fraud are on the rise.
  • Criminals are increasingly using automation, bots, and even AI to exploit weaknesses in online systems.
  • Businesses are responding with a mix of preventative strategies, from basic controls to advanced AI-powered fraud detection tools.
  • A strong fraud strategy now requires not just technology, but also staff training, customer awareness, and expert support.
